To See In QLD - Blackwater Coal Museum

 


We saw the big red bucket on our way to the Gemfields, and decided to visit on the way back. Little miss loved posing in the big red bucket, its hard to realise just how big the equipment is for open cut mining. It made me feel so small standing in that bucket. The museum had heaps of interactive exhibits and information about coal mining. 

There was heaps of information about what coal is used for and I have to say I was really surprised at how many everyday items that coal mining. Little miss loved the old coal train. I loved the models and how the different kinds of mines are cut and different jobs in a mine.
